Different Coordination Modes of a Tripod Phosphine in Gold(I) andSilver(I) Complexes

摘要

The following gold(I) and silver(I) complexes of the tritertiary phosphine 1,1,1- tris(diphenylphosphinomethyl)ethane, tripod , have been synthesised: Au3(tripod)X3 [X = Cl(>1), Br(>2), I(>3)]; [Au3(tripod)2Cl2]Cl (>4); Au(tripod)X [X = Br(>5), I(>6)]; Ag3(tripod) (NO3)4 (>7), Ag(tripod)NO3 (>8). They were characterized by X-ray diffraction (complexes >2, >3 and >4), 31P NMR spectroscopy, electrospray and FAB mass spectrometry and infrared spectroscopy. Complexes >2 and >3 show a linear coordination geometry for Au(I), with relatively short Au-P bond distances. Complex >3 has a Au•••Au intramolecular distance of 3.326 A ° ,while complex >2 had a short Au•••Au intermolecular interaction of 3.048 A ° . Complexes >4-6 were found by31P NMR spectroscopy studies to contain a mixture of species in solution, one of which crystallised as[Au3(tripod|)2Cl2]Cl which was shown by X-ray diffraction to contain both tetrahedral and linear Au(I), thefirst example of a Au(I) complex containing such a mixture of geometries. The reaction of [Au3(tripod)Cl3] (>1)with tripod led successfully to the formation of [Au3(tripod|)2Cl2]+ and [Au3(tripod)2Cl3]+ and [Au3(tripod|)3Cl]2+. The silver(I)complexes, >7 and >8 appear to contain linear and tetrahedral Ag(I), respectively.
